INSTALLATION FOR SINGLE PLAYER
1. First you need to have the ASI Loader installed, I am not gonna teach you how for this step, it should be very basic for GTAV modding.
2. Launch the game and disable all AA, and switch to Borderless, this must be done before installing the mod.
3. If you want to use other graphic mods such as NVE or QuentV, install their ReShade first.
4. Delete the dxgi.dll and d3d12.dll if it's in the game's root folder after you have installed their ReShade.
5. Extract all content to the game's root folder, overwrite the dxgi.asi.
6. Enable Vsync for GTA5.exe in Nvidia Control Panel, this is improtent!
7. When you have launched the game, open ReShade menu using either Home Or Insert, the upscaler's menu should also be shown with ReShade's menu.
NOTE: If you are using QuantV, open QuantV.preset.ini and set Vehicle_Carbon and Vehicle_Raindrops to 0.

INSTALLATION FOR FIVEM
1. Launch the game and disable all AA, and switch to Fullscreen (without Exclusive), this must be done before installing the mod.
2. Extract all content to FiveM\FiveM.app\plugins.
3. If you want to use other graphic mods such as NVE or QuentV, install their ReShade first.
4. Delete the dxgi.dll if it's in plugins folder, it's probably another ReShade.
5. Rename dxgi.asi to dxgi.dll if you want to use FiveM's UI lag fix.
6. Enable Vsync for FiveM_bXXXX_GTAProcess (located in FiveM\FiveM.app\data\cache\subprocess) in Nvidia Control Panel, this is improtent!
7. When you have launched the game, open ReShade menu using either Home Or Insert, the upscaler's menu should also be shown with ReShade's menu.
NOTE: If you are using QuantV, open QuantV.preset.ini and set Vehicle_Carbon and Vehicle_Raindrops to 0.
